“What were the biggest nail trends of the year?”

Lauren reflects back. “In 2018 we saw a lot of moody deep tones on nails,” she said. By moody, we’re talking about the deep blues, purples and reds along with mixed metals like copper, gold and silver Combined with leathery earthy nude polish colors, the nail scene was down with the dark.

“However, a great nude never goes out of style and is classically chic.”

In regard to nail art, Lauren saw it have a moment in 2018. “We are starting to see more studs, jewelry, beads, chains etc. on nails and this is probably not going away, “ she said. “We saw an array of abstract designs, minimal designs and modern designs consisting of lines, dots, negative space, brush strokes, and more!”

But that’s not the only fad on the rise, says Lauren. “I think we will see more of the Negative Space manicure.”

If you’re confused by the term, no worries! Nail expert extraordinaire explains the latest LA trend.

“Negative Space is a clear base coat applied onto the nail,  then designs using bold lines, colors on the tips only, words or phrases, elevated versions of the traditional french manicure, or a mix of all these. These are not only on trend, they are also forgiving, since nail growth does not show as easily.”

Another contender for trending is glitter, Lauren speculates. “This year I believe we will see a lot of sparkle and all things glitter. I love combining the negative space manicure by starting with a clear base and then playing with glitter. Especially  using glitter to create a crescent moon at the base, or along one side, or as a design even a simple negative nail with glitter on top. Glitter is a form of texture very appealing on nails.

“I always say nails should be your best accessory, and now we are seeing jewelry combined literally on your fingertips.”

And what about the shape of the nails and nail care? Coffins were super popular, but Lauren believes that practical, natural shapes will be on top this round.  “We will see shapes like medium length ovals and styles that are  clean and easy to achieve,” she said.

“And as clean beauty becomes more and more popular, customers will become more aware of harsh chemicals in nail polish and nail services.”
